What Makes a Casino Trusted in Niagara?

When you search for a trusted casino Niagara experience, you are really looking for three things: a valid licence, transparent terms and a track record of paying winnings on time. In Ontario and the rest of Canada, reputable operators hold licences from the Malta Gaming Authority, UK Gambling Commission or the Kahnawake Gaming Commission. Those licences guarantee that the casino follows strict anti‑fraud rules and undergoes regular audits.

Beyond the licence, trust also shows up in the fine print. Look for clear wagering requirements, no hidden fees on deposits or withdrawals, and a privacy policy that respects Canadian data laws. When the operator publishes its RTP (return‑to‑player) percentages for slot games, you have another clue that it is not trying to hide the house edge.

How to Verify a Casino Before You Deposit

First step is to locate the licence number on the casino’s footer. Click the licence link and confirm the jurisdiction; a quick Google search of the licence ID will show you if it’s still active. Next, check independent review sites that specialise in Canadian gambling – they often list the latest audit reports and player complaints.

If you’re still unsure, open a support ticket and ask a specific question about withdrawal limits or KYC documents. A trustworthy casino will reply within a few hours and give a straight answer without trying to push a bonus you don’t need.

Bonuses, Welcome Offers and Wagering Requirements

Bonuses are the biggest lure, but the fine print can turn a “big” welcome bonus into a costly obligation. Look for a bonus that offers a reasonable wagering requirement – something like 20x or less on the bonus amount. A 100% match up to $200 with a 20x requirement is far more player‑friendly than a 300% match with a 50x requirement.

Also, check whether the casino limits the games you can use the bonus on. Some operators only allow low‑RTP slots, which reduces your chances of clearing the wager. Payment Methods and Withdrawal Speed

Canadian players expect a variety of deposit options: Interac e‑Transfer, credit cards, PayPal and several e‑wallets. The best‑rated casinos also accept Instadebit and bank transfers without extra fees. When it comes to withdrawals, “instant payouts” usually mean the casino processes the request within 24 hours, but the actual money may take 2‑3 business days to appear in your bank.

Make sure you verify the minimum and maximum withdrawal limits before you start playing. A common pitfall is signing up for a big bonus only to discover the casino caps withdrawals at $500 per week – that can be frustrating if you hit a big win.

Customer Support, Verification and Security

Reliable customer support should be reachable via live chat, email and telephone, and be available at least during North American business hours. When you contact support, ask about the verification process – a trusted casino will ask for a government‑issued ID and a proof‑of‑address document, but never ask for your password.

Security wise, look for the padlock icon in the browser address bar and read the privacy policy. Encryption standards like TLS 1.2 or higher are a baseline expectation. If a site mentions “responsible gambling tools” such as deposit limits or self‑exclusion, that’s another point in its favour.
